What should you do first when HVAC fails in Anoka County?
Winter turns failures into emergencies here. With lows near 4 degrees, a dead heating system threatens occupants and plumbing the same night. Getting someone out quickly is realistic in Anoka outside of peak weather events, when everyone calls at once and triage takes over. Budget 1.5 to 2 times standard pricing for after hours work.
The pre call checklist is short: thermostat mode and batteries, the breakers for both indoor and outdoor equipment, the service switch by the furnace, the filter, and the float switch in the drain pan. Clearing all five means the problem is genuinely mechanical, which is worth telling the dispatcher.
If you smell gas, leave the building before calling anyone, then contact your gas utility from outside. If a carbon monoxide alarm sounds, get everyone out and call 911. See our HVAC safety guide for the situations that warrant shutting a system down immediately.

Package unit and rooftop service in Anoka
Package units combine everything in one outdoor cabinet, common on slab homes and manufactured housing, and repairs typically run $195 to $780 locally. Full exposure means every component ages in the weather rather than half of them living indoors, which is the main tradeoff against the simpler installation. Cabinet corrosion, failed condenser fan motors, and gas section problems on heating models account for most calls.
Evaporator and condenser coil service in Anoka
Coil cleaning runs $107 to $430 locally, while coil replacement costs $995 to $2,775. Airborne dust and vegetation debris mat outdoor coils gradually, and a fouled condenser raises energy use 20 to 30 percent while shortening compressor life. A garden hose rinse from inside the cabinet outward, done with the power off, handles routine maintenance at no cost.
Duct repair and sealing in Anoka
Duct sealing typically costs $560 to $2,250 here and is frequently the best money spent on an HVAC system. Studies consistently find a fifth to a third of conditioned air escaping before it reaches a room, which no equipment upgrade can compensate for. The symptoms are rooms that never reach setpoint, dust that returns immediately after cleaning, and bills that outpace the weather.
Thermostat replacement in Anoka
Thermostat replacement runs $166 to $550 locally including installation. Genuine thermostat failure is less common than the alternatives, so rule out batteries, breakers, and the float switch first. Upgrading is worthwhile, but confirm your system has a C wire before buying, since power stealing designs cause intermittent faults.
How do you choose an HVAC contractor in Anoka?
Installation and repair quality vary far more than equipment brands do. In a market this size, marketing spend and actual competence correlate poorly, which is why these checks exist. Every item here is something a professional answers comfortably.
- For replacements, ask whether they perform a Manual J load calculation, since sizing by matching the old unit perpetuates whatever error was made decades ago
- Check whether the company pulls permits for replacements, because skipping permits is a reliable indicator of what else gets skipped
- Verify the state license and ask for a certificate of insurance. Minnesota requires licensing for HVAC work, and legitimate contractors produce both without hesitation
- Ask to see the failed part or the diagnostic reading, since reputable technicians show their evidence without being asked twice
- Insist on a written, itemized quote separating diagnosis, parts, and labor, because single number quotes prevent comparison and hide padding
- Ask what the labor warranty covers and for how long, which is entirely separate from the manufacturer's parts warranty

Should you repair or replace your system in Anoka County?
The repair or replace decision follows the 5,000 rule: multiply the system's age in years by the repair quote, and above 5,000, replacement usually wins. Locally, full replacement costs $5,550 to $13,850, which frames every large repair decision you will face. A system on its second major failure in two seasons is telling you something the arithmetic will not. Factor in the 20 to 40 percent efficiency gain and available rebates before assuming repair is the cheaper path.

Are HVAC rebates or tax credits available in Minnesota?
Yes, and they stack. The federal 25C credit returns 30 percent of qualifying costs, up to $2,000 for heat pumps and $600 each for qualifying air conditioners and furnaces. State administered Home Energy Rebates add up to $8,000 toward heat pumps for income qualified households. Utility rebates typically add another $100 to $2,000 depending on your provider and the equipment tier. Confirm eligibility before signing, because point of sale rebates only flow through contractors registered with the relevant program.
What size HVAC system does a home in Anoka need?
Sizing requires a Manual J load calculation, not a square footage rule of thumb, and any contractor who skips it is guessing. Local climate matters to that calculation: 83 degree summers and 4 degree winters set the design conditions the equipment must meet. Oversizing is the more common error and it causes short cycling, poor humidity removal, and premature compressor wear. Matching the tonnage of an old unit simply inherits whatever mistake was made when that unit was installed.
When should I schedule HVAC maintenance in Anoka?
Fall is the critical appointment in Anoka. Schedule a heating inspection in October, before the roughly 7 month heating season. Insist on combustion analysis and heat exchanger inspection, which are the checks that stand between normal operation and carbon monoxide exposure. Add a spring cooling check to complete the schedule, and book both in the shoulder months when rates are standard.
Do I need a licensed HVAC contractor in Minnesota?
Yes for essentially all mechanical work. Minnesota requires licensing for HVAC installation and repair, and federal law separately requires EPA Section 608 certification for anyone handling refrigerant. Homeowners can legally change filters, clean condenser coils, clear condensate drains, and replace standard thermostats. Anything involving refrigerant circuits, gas piping, or sealed electrical compartments belongs to a licensed professional, both for legal reasons and because those are the failures that injure people.
